two.2.4) Description of the procurement

OraQuick HCV test detects antibodies against hepatitis C virus and can be used on oral fluid, finger stick blood, venous blood, plasma or serum, giving results in 20–40 minutes. Eleven published studies showed that the OraQuick HCV has very high sensitivity and specificity

Explanation:

The OraQuick HCV test detects antibodies against hepatitis C virus and can be used on oral fluid, finger stick blood, venous blood, plasma or serum, giving results in 20–40 minutes. Eleven published studies showed that the OraQuick HCV has very high sensitivity and specificity.

There are no alternative suppliers who have the CE marked technology for the OraQuick HCV rapid antibody test.

As such, there are no identified alternative suppliers who can complete all of the following elements as one test:

- The OraQuick HCV rapid antibody test plus absorbent packet

- An OraQuick HCV developer solution (0.75ml phosphate buffered saline solution containing polymers and a antimicrobial agent)

- Reusable test stands

- Collection loops

- Package insert

- Rapid HCV results ready in 20-40 minutes

- The OraQuick HCV test comes with quality control reagents include:

- When each new operator is using the kit

- Whenever a new test it lot is opened

- Whenever the kit storage area falls outside of 2C-30C

- Whenever the kit testing area fall outside of 15C-37C
